Planning appeal decision

Allowed14 January 20266000713

25 Brockley Avenue, Stanmore, London, HA7 4LT

a two storey side extension following demolition of existing garage. Part single, part two storey rear extension with 3 nos. rooflight to ground floor flat roof. Part single, part two storey front extension. Alterations and extension to roof including raising of main ridge height, rear gable feature, side dormer, front and side facing rooflights, and removal of chimneys. Installation of 9 no. solar panels to side roof slope. Fenestration changes including rear Juliette balcony, replacement of existing windows, and removal of side ground floor window

Authority
London Borough of Barnet
Appeal type
householder · Householder (HAS)
Procedure
Written Representations
Development
residential · Householder developments

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them

  • The effect of the proposed development on the character and appearance of the host building and the surrounding area

What decided it

The proposed roof form, despite the raised ridgeline and rear gable, would respond sensitively to the character of the area by retaining a hipped form consistent with the predominant architectural style of Brockley Avenue and remaining proportionate to the resulting building.

Plan policies cited: Policy CDH01, Policy CDH05, Policy D3
